Strategic Publishing Alliance

Cold River Games has formally partnered with PlayPark, a renowned game publisher with a robust presence in Southeast Asia, to distribute its upcoming action RPG, Crystalfall. PlayPark, under Asphere Innovations PLC, will help leverage its regional influence and expertise, following successful prior collaborations with major entities like Blizzard Entertainment and Sony Online Entertainment. This partnership aims to enhance the game’s visibility and accessibility across a significant user base.

Gamescom Asia: A Platform for New Reveals

The collaborative efforts will be showcased at Gamescom Asia, slated for October 17-19 in Thailand, where the gaming community will receive an exclusive first look at Crystalfall’s latest build. This event will also mark the introduction of the new Technomancer class – a unique blend of crow-human traits with steampunk influences, expanding upon the existing roster that includes the Gunner and the Knight, each offering distinct gameplay styles.

Early Access and Game Features

Looking ahead to Early Access in early 2026, Crystalfall is poised to offer a rich gameplay experience across five acts, supporting multiplayer modes, and available in 12 languages. This phase will allow Cold River Games to refine the game based on comprehensive player feedback, aimed at perfecting the endgame scenarios and overall game mechanics. The plot unveils a post-apocalyptic world reshaped by a massive asteroid impact, filled with mutated creatures and mechanical adversaries, promising a deep and engaging storyline.

Strategic Funding and Development Insights

In a recent financing round in July, Cold River Games secured $2 million, spearheaded by Beam Investments with additional support from various backers. CEO Ã…ke André reflects on the significance of this financial milestone amidst a challenging funding landscape, expressing satisfaction with the engagement of a Swedish investor in a Swedish game studio. “It means a lot we were successful with a Swedish investor coming into a Swedish game studio. I’m very happy,” he stated.
